> This patch adds a DRM ENUM property to the selected connectors.
> This property is used for mentioning the protected content's type
> from userspace to kernel HDCP authentication.
> 
> Type of the stream is decided by the protected content providers.
> Type 0 content can be rendered on any HDCP protected display wires.
> But Type 1 content can be rendered only on HDCP2.2 protected paths.
> 
> So when a userspace sets this property to Type 1 and starts the HDCP
> enable, kernel will honour it only if HDCP2.2 authentication is through
> for type 1. Else HDCP enable will be failed.

> + * HDCP Content Type:
> + *   This property is used by the userspace to configure the kernel with
> + *   to be displayed stream's content type. Content Type of a stream is
> + *   decided by the owner of the stream, as HDCP Type0 or HDCP Type1.
> + *
> + *   The value of the property can be one the below:
> + *     - DRM_MODE_HDCP_CONTENT_TYPE0 = 0

If this doc is meant as the UAPI doc, it needs to use the string names
for enum property values, not the C language definitions (integers).

> + *           HDCP Type0 streams can be transmitted on a link which is
> + *           encrypted with HDCP 1.4 or HDCP 2.2.

This wording forbids using any future HDCP version for type0.

> + *     - DRM_MODE_HDCP_CONTENT_TYPE1 = 1
> + *           HDCP Type1 streams can be transmitted on a link which is
> + *           encrypted only with HDCP 2.2.

This wording forbids using any future HDCP version for type1.

> + *
> + *   Note that the HDCP Content Type property is specific to HDCP 2.2, and
> + *   defaults to type 0. It is only exposed by drivers supporting HDCP 2.2

Not possible with a future HDCP version greater than 2.2?

Is it intended to be possible to add more content types in the future?

> + *   If content type is changed when content_protection is not UNDESIRED,
> + *   then kernel will disable the HDCP and re-enable with new type in the
> + *   same atomic commit

Ok, very good to mention this.

> +/* Content Type classification for HDCP2.2 vs others */
> +#define DRM_MODE_HDCP_CONTENT_TYPE0          0
> +#define DRM_MODE_HDCP_CONTENT_TYPE1          1

These should not be in a UAPI header. The C language definitions must
never be exposed to userspace, or misguided userspace will start using
them.

Instead, UAPI uses the string names to discover the integers at runtime.

***

Questions about the already existing "Content Protection" property:

- What happens if userspace attempts to write "Enabled" into it?

- Where is the UAPI documentation that explains how userspace should be
  using the property? (e.g. telling that you cannot set it to "Enabled")
